#1c0454 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1c0454 is composed of 11% red, 1.6%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66.7% cyan, 95.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.1% black. It has a hue angle of 258 degrees, a saturation of 90.9% and a lightness of 17.3%. #1c0454 color hex could be obtained by blending #3808a8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

#1c0454 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1c0454 has RGB values of R:28, G:4, B:84 and CMYK values of C:0.67,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 1836116.

Shades and Tints of #1c0454
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030009 is the darkest color, while #f8f5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1c0454
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2b292f is the less saturated color, while #1b0157 is the most saturated one.
